Builder

open class Builder

Configクラスの生成を行うためのクラスです。

Constructors

Builder
Link copied to clipboard
fun Builder()

Functions

apiKey
Link copied to clipboard
fun apiKey(apiKey: String): Config.Builder
Config.apiKeyを変更します。 設定ファイルから自動でロードされる値以外を利用したい場合にのみ設定します。
appKey
Link copied to clipboard
fun appKey(appKey: String): Config.Builder
Config.appKeyを変更します。 設定ファイルから自動でロードされる値以外を利用したい場合にのみ設定します。
baseUrl
Link copied to clipboard
fun baseUrl(baseUrl: String): Config.Builder
Config.baseUrlを変更します。 URLを変更することで、地域や環境を設定することができます。設定ファイルから自動でロードされる値以外を利用したい場合にのみ設定します。
build
Link copied to clipboard
open fun build(): Config
Configクラスのインスタンスを生成します。
dataLocation
Link copied to clipboard
fun dataLocation(dataLocation: String): Config.Builder
Config.dataLocationを変更します。 設定ファイルから自動でロードされる値以外を利用したい場合にのみ設定します。
enabledTrackingAaid
Link copied to clipboard
fun enabledTrackingAaid(enabledTrackingAaid: Boolean): Config.Builder
Config.enabledTrackingAaidを変更します。
equals
Link copied to clipboard
open operator fun equals(other: Any?): Boolean
hashCode
Link copied to clipboard
open fun hashCode(): Int
isDryRun
Link copied to clipboard
fun isDryRun(isDryRun: Boolean): Config.Builder
Config.isDryRunを変更します。
isOptOut
Link copied to clipboard
fun isOptOut(isOptOut: Boolean): Config.Builder
Config.isOptOutを変更します。
libraryConfigs
Link copied to clipboard
fun libraryConfigs(vararg libraryConfigs: LibraryConfig): Config.Builder
Config.libraryConfigsを変更します。
fun libraryConfigs(libraryConfigs: List<LibraryConfig>): Config.Builder
Config.libraryConfigsを変更します。
toString
Link copied to clipboard
open fun toString(): String

Properties

apiKey
Link copied to clipboard
var apiKey: String
Config.apiKeyを変更します。 設定ファイルから自動でロードされる値以外を利用したい場合にのみ設定します。
appKey
Link copied to clipboard
var appKey: String
Config.appKeyを変更します。 設定ファイルから自動でロードされる値以外を利用したい場合にのみ設定します。
baseUrl
Link copied to clipboard
var baseUrl: String
Config.baseUrlを変更します。 URLを変更することで、地域や環境を設定することができます。設定ファイルから自動でロードされる値以外を利用したい場合にのみ設定します。
dataLocation
Link copied to clipboard
var dataLocation: String
Config.dataLocationを変更します。 設定ファイルから自動でロードされる値以外を利用したい場合にのみ設定します。
enabledTrackingAaid
Link copied to clipboard
var enabledTrackingAaid: Boolean = false
Config.enabledTrackingAaidを変更します。
isDryRun
Link copied to clipboard
var isDryRun: Boolean = false
Config.isDryRunを変更します。
isOptOut
Link copied to clipboard
var isOptOut: Boolean = false
Config.isOptOutを変更します。
libraryConfigs
Link copied to clipboard
var libraryConfigs: List<LibraryConfig>
Config.libraryConfigsを変更します。

Inheritors

ExperimentalConfig
Link copied to clipboard